Intelligent MPPT Solar Charging

The integrated MPPT solar charge controller continuously tracks the maximum available power from the photovoltaic array.

It automatically adjusts the operating point according to changes in sunlight and panel temperature, helping improve daily solar energy generation and charging efficiency.

Hybrid Solar, Battery and Grid Management

The inverter coordinates power from:

  • Solar panels
  • Battery storage
  • Utility grid
  • Connected electrical loads

During daylight hours, solar energy can directly power the loads and charge the battery. When solar generation is insufficient, the inverter can use battery or utility power according to the selected operating priority.

Lithium Battery BMS Communication

Selected models may support communication with compatible lithium battery management systems through interfaces such as:

  • CAN
  • RS485
  • RS232

When communication is correctly configured, the inverter may monitor battery information including:

  • State of charge
  • Battery voltage
  • Charging current
  • Discharging current
  • Battery temperature
  • Warning status
  • Fault information

Battery communication protocols are not universal. Compatibility must be verified before ordering.

How the System Works

During the daytime, solar panels generate DC electricity.

The inverter converts solar energy into AC electricity for connected loads. When solar generation exceeds current consumption, excess energy can be used to charge the battery.

When solar production decreases, stored battery energy can support the connected loads. If both solar and battery power are insufficient, utility electricity can provide additional power when available.

During a grid outage, the inverter can continue supplying designated backup loads when sufficient battery energy is available.
